Building Specialized SAP SuccessFactors Knowledge
One of the biggest benefits of SAP LMS training is the opportunity to develop specialized knowledge. Instead of learning SAP SuccessFactors only at a general level, learners can focus on SAP SuccessFactors Learning, including LMS administration, learning processes, courses, learning items, curricula, programs, assessments, assignments, instructors, and learning resources. This specialization can help learners establish a clearer professional direction within SAP SuccessFactors.

Strengthening Reporting and Analytics Skills
Modern organizations rely heavily on data to evaluate employee development and training effectiveness. SAP SuccessFactors LMS includes learning-related reporting and analytics capabilities that help organizations monitor training completion, learning progress, certification status, and compliance activities. Training in these areas can help professionals understand how learning data supports business decisions and workforce development.
Understanding Implementation Projects
A practical SAP LMS course can also introduce learners to implementation concepts such as requirement gathering, business process analysis, configuration planning, testing, deployment, documentation, and post-implementation support. Understanding the overall implementation lifecycle can help learners see how LMS solutions are designed around organizational requirements rather than simply learning individual system features.
